发明名称 BIOCHEMICAL ANALYTICAL METHOD USING STORAGE PHOSPHOR
摘要 PROBLEM TO BE SOLVED: To provide a biochemical detecting method using fluorescence labeling and a biochemical analytical method which has high detection sensitivity, good S/N ratio and high precision. SOLUTION: The biochemical detecting method to detect a target substance included in a sample comprises a process to form a probe-target substance compound material 4 by a biochemical specific bonding caused by making a contact with a sample including a target substance to be detected and a probe 3 enabling to biochemically bond with the target substance, a process to obtain a labeled probe-target substance compound material which is labeled with a storage phosphor by adhering storage phosphor particles to the probe of the probe-target substance compound material 4, a process to accumulate primary excitation energy to the storage phosphor included in the labeled probe-target substance compound material by applying primary excitation energy to the sample including the labeled probe-target substance compound material, and a process to detect radiated light emitted from the storage phosphor in the labeled probe-target substance compound material by applying secondly excitation energy to the sample. Since a light having a long wavelength is used as the secondly excitation energy light to detect luminescence, photodecomposition and background noises which generally occur in organic dyes can be avoided.
